In Labour Day message: Buzdar announces raising minimum wage to Rs20,000


Top Story
May 2, 2021
LAHORE: Chief Minister Punjab Usman Buzdar, on the occasion of Labour Day on Saturday said that the provincial government would raise the minimum wage in the province to Rs20,000.
The chief minister, in a statement, said 1,296 flats have also been allotted to workers in Lahore, Nankana Sahib, and Multan.
Buzdar said that the welfare of the labour class is the government's priority and that it had increased the minimum wage by Rs5,000 in the last three years.
“The previous governments did not pay attention to the welfare of labourers [...] We have suspended the outdated methods and launched an online platform for labour inspection,” he said. The chief minister said the marriage grant for labourers has been increased from Rs 100,000 to Rs 200,000. Labour Day — also known as May Day — is observed around the world to express solidarity with and honour the rights of the labour class. The purpose of celebrating this day is to initiate steps to provide job protection to labourers and industrial workers against any exploitation.

Traders reject govt's decision about business closure: Govt urged to increase minimum wage of workers


National
May 2, 2021
PESHAWAR: The trader community on Saturday rejected the government’s decision to close down business for nine days and urged the rulers to announce Eid holiday from May 12 to May 15 and allow them to continue business after 6pm.
The announcement was made at a meeting held in connection with May 1 and asked the government to end the ban on their business on Saturday and Sunday till Eidul Fitr so that the people could purchase the required items. Mujeebur Rehman, the president of the union chaired the meeting. The traders rejected the government decision to close down the country for nine days, saying the NCOC should take the traders into confidence before taking such decisions. They said the closing of business for nine days would badly affect the already affected small traders.

CM approves Rs 20,000 minimum wages for workers


CM approves Rs 20,000 minimum wages for workers
Lahore
May 2, 2021
LAHORE: Chief Minister Usman Buzdar on Labour Day has given approval to fix minimum wages at Rs 20,000.
Chairing a meeting in connection with providing relief to the labourers at the CM’s Office here on Saturday, the chief minister said the welfare of the labourers and workers was the top priority of the government and Punjab was the only province that had given approval to fix the minimum wages at Rs 20,000.
He said the PTI government in the last three years had increased Rs 5000 in the minimum wages of workers and would continue to increase the minimum wages of workers in future as well.
